"How about I'll just simply go to the Evergreen royal family's castle for the meantime instead?" Elvis can't help but suggest. He explained, "In this way, they will no longer assume things since they can see me personally with the Evergreen royal family. This will also allow us to avoid an unexpected accident, such as finding me in the Smiling Lion Village. As long as the Naughty Elves organization can see me in the castle, all of their suspicions would certainly be dropped and they will focus their attention entirely on the Evergreen royal family,"
Hearing Elvis's suggestion, Ethan nodded his head before expressing his thoughts, "Although doing this would also be the same as using the Evergreen royal family to clear the trouble for us, but I still completely agree with Elvis. You have already mentioned to us that we have a very clear and important mission during the Emerald Elven Battle Competition, and that we should do all we can in order to prevent the Naughty Elves organization from knowing anything about this and also prevent them from ruining what the Evergreen royal family is exactly planning to do against them,"
"And besides, having Elvis here or not during the Emerald Elven Battle Competition doesn't really matter that much to the Mischievous Lion Guild, right? Since the Intelligence Department has already finished gathering all the relevant informations that we needed and our next mission would also be to assist the alliance of the Evergreen royal family. It is just perfect to have Elvis there with the Evergreen royal family already so that he will be up to date on whatever they are planning on doing," Ethan paused as he turned to look at Elvis, "And aside from that, it is very obvious already that this is also what Elvis really wanted. After all, he is the person with the lowest kill count during yesterday's operation. Hence, going to the Evergreen royal family's castle would allow him to avoid his punishment,"

"Regardless of going to the Evergreen royal family's castle or not, Elvis would still be receiving his punishment. It will only be postponed for a couple of days due to the importance of the problem we are currently facing," Leo shook his head. He would definitely not allow Elvis to have a way out. This is his only chance of avoiding working in the office for a month straight, at least at this point in time.
Elvis's face instantly became ugly the moment he heard Leo's words. That was indeed the main reason why he had suggested going to the Evergreen royal family's castle. Unfortunately, Ethan was able to realize this and didn't hesitate to reveal it to Leo. Honestly speaking though, he was actually somewhat expecting this already, especially considering that no one amongst everyone that participated in yesterday's operation really wanted to work in the office. And since there is no use hiding this secret anymore, he could only heave a sigh of helplessness and admit to it, "Fine, I'm still going to work in the office for a month straight once everything is over, happy now?"
"Very happy!" Elaine replied with a smile on her face.
"Absolutely!" Edward would of course not allow himself to be left behind in adding more salt to Ethan's wounds.
Chief Lago and the others also expressed their agreement and opinion with Elvis' matter of not being able to escape his punishment. In short, all of them were delighted to know about this.
Seeing that everyone has agreed with Elvis' idea, Leo then said, "Anyways, we are more or less finished with our meeting here already," He turned to look at Elvis before saying, "Elvis, pack all of the things you needed because you will be staying in the Evergreen royal family's castle. Also, bring all of your men from the Night Ear group along so that you will have some people to protect you in close proximity that you trust. Be sure to disguise yourself during your travel so that no one will be able to know that you left from the Smiling Lion Village, understood?"

"Yes, Guild Leader Leo," Elvis nodded his head in affirmation.
"Meeting dismissed, everyone, prepare for the ball tomorrow evening," Leo stood up before quickly leaving the meeting room.
While wearing a disguise to prevent them from being recognized by anyone else other than Leo and the others, Elvis and all of the men of the Night Ear group left the Smiling Lion Village through one of the secret tunnels. They then slowly made their way towards Emerald City.
As soon as they arrived in the Emerald City, they will then immediately communicate with the men sent by the Evergreen royal family who are in charge of the anti-reconnaissance mission and help them travel to the castle without anyone noticing.
While that was taking place, Leo and the others, specifically Cassandra, Elizabeth, Angel, Veronica, Ash, Charlotte, Edward, Sele, Dan, Sebastian, Iasiah, Nightingale, Eilajah, and Steve left openly through the main gate of the Smiling Lion Village using five carriages and made their way towards the Emerald City. The reason for doing such a conspicuous move was so that they can attract the attention of the hiding members of the Naughty Elves organization amongst the crowd in the Smiling Lion Village and prevent them from noticing anything is wrong in the Mischievous Lion Guild.
It didn't really took them that long to see the walls of the Emerald City in front of them. In the past, the road in-between the two territories of the Smiling Lion Village and the Emerald City was made merely from dirt and various sizes of rocks with some occasional slopes every now and then, thus it was so bumpy and hard to travel by. But as the Smiling Lion Village continues to prosper and with many people visiting the place, both the Mischievous Lion Guild and the Evergreen royal family had decided to cooperate with each other in making a stone road that allowed everyone a smooth and fast travel in either of the two territories.
